VS Code Remote SSH Extension
This isn't an IDE itself, but the Remote SSH extension for VS Code is a critical tool for local development when your actual machine is weak or you need to work on a powerful remote server. It makes the remote machine feel like the local machine, allowing you to run the full IDE experience on powerful, dedicated hardware without needing a local GUI.

Visual Studio Code (with R Debugger Extension)
While VS Code itself is general, its specific configuration with robust R debugging extensions allows it to function as a powerful local IDE alternative. Its strength lies in its massive ecosystem and excellent graphical debugging tools. This setup is ideal for users migrating from other mainstream IDEs who need a familiar, feature-rich GUI while maintaining local control.
